    FR F40's are pricy, but they are not made of brass. They shell is injection molded. What makes it special is a big can motor and a gigantic flywheel. It runs great and pulls like a F7.

    for the F40PH youd want to use the F59PHi chassis from AZL, its a solid performer, and the F59PHi is only 2' longer than the F40PH in real life anyway... which would be about 2.5mm which if it really bothered you, you could shave the mech down. also another bonus is you could also use the rear pilot since they were designed like the F40PHs anyway.

    on my work bench this weekend
    Adding LED's to some BLMA # 8000 Target Signal Heads
    all 3 have a RED/GREEN LED shoehorned inside
    the 4th didn't make the cut (CA didn't work near as well as soldering did for me)
